High pressure water injection pumps for oil fields
Water injection is used during oil production to increase the amount of the oil in a reservoir that is able to be extracted. Without it only around 30% of available oil is usually retrieved. The process sees water being injected into the bottom of the reservoir to increase pressure within it and essentially push the oil towards the well. By essentially replacing the oil that has been recovered, the pressure remains the same keeping the reservoir in production.
In order to achieve the high pressures required, water injection pumps are installed in oil fields and rigs. We offer a full range of centrifugal pumps and side channel pumps for this application. As much of oil recovery is done offshore, seawater is usually the most available source of water for the injection process. For seawater injection pumps we specify the casing in bronze; a cost effective alternative to stainless steel whilst being durable and resistant to corrosion caused by salt.
